"Following the approval of the General Election Commissioner, the printing of ballot papers for the European elections has begun this morning and will continue until Monday. This will be followed by the printing of the remaining ballot papers for local government.

The Government Printing Office will be working late into the evening and at weekends every day so that we can be ready by the beginning of June. In total, about 1,050 different ballot papers will be printed and the total number of ballot papers will amount to 3.5 million.
